Kuwait Money

Kuwait Money

Currency: Kuwait Dinar (KD) = 1000 fils. Notes are in denominations of KD20, 10, 5 and 1, and 500 and 250 fils. Coins are in denominations of 100, 50, 20, 10, 5 and 1 fils.

Credit & debit cards: American Express, Diners Club, MasterCard and Visa are accepted. Check with your credit or debit card company for details of merchant acceptability and other services which may be available.

Travellers cheques: Widely accepted. To avoid additional exchange rate charges, travellers are advised to take travellers cheques in US Dollars or Pounds Sterling.

Currency restrictions: The import and export of local and foreign currency is not restricted.

Exchange rate indicators: The following figures are included as a guide to the movements of the Kuwait Dinar against Sterling and the US Dollar:

Date May '04 Aug '04 Nov '04 Feb '05
£1.00 = 0.53 0.54 0.55 0.55
$1.00= 0.30 0.29 0.29 0.29

Banking hours: Sun-Thurs 0800-1200.
